Mary Elizabeth Toy

Mary Toy Obituary

Mary Elizabeth Toy joined her Lord on Tuesday, August 12, 2003, she was 77 years old. Born in Phoenix on June 9, 1926, she graduated from Phoenix Union High School and Phoenix College. During her school years, she was active in sports and sold War Bonds during World War II. She married Grey K. Toy on June 26, 1949, and joined his family's business at Toy's Shangri-La as hostess and cashier. Later she worked with her son, Grey, Jr., as cashier and accountant for Phoenix Fishing. For over fifty years she was a member of the Historic First Presbyterian Church of Phoenix. She is survived by her husband Grey, her son, Grey Jr., both of Phoenix and her daughter and son-in-law Debra and Frank Law of Highland, CA.
